Position Introduction/Key Duties


Cimarron is seeking a mid-level Guidance Navigation & Controls Engineerto rapidly prototype, develop, and field novel space and hypersonic capabilities. ESG delivers first-of-kind solutions for customers in a fast-paced, multidisciplinary environment. You will design GN&C algorithms, build high‑fidelity simulations, implement and test flight software, and support integration and flight test in both atmospheric and space.


Key Duties:



  • Design, implement, and verify guidance, navigation, and control algorithms for spacecraft, re-entry vehicles, and hypersonic/airborne platforms.

  • Develop and maintain 6‑DOF dynamics simulations and associated analysis tools for mission and performance assessment.

  • Implement and validate GN&C flight software (MATLAB/Simulink models and C/C++ prototypes) and integrate with testbeds and avionics.

  • Apply astrodynamics and flight mechanics to mission design, novel orbit concepts, and trajectory optimization.

  • Apply aerodynamics, atmospheric flight mechanics, and controls knowledge to support the design of re-entry guidance, navigation, and flight control functions

  • Develop powered and unpowered guidance laws and autonomy tools for on‑orbit and atmospheric operations.

  • Support troubleshooting of operational anomalies, functional tests, and service incidents.

  • Produce concepts of operations, simulation artifacts, and test procedures to enable rapid iteration from prototype to flight test.

  • Collaborate with cross‑functional teams (systems engineering, avionics, test, and business development) and communicate technical tradeoffs to stakeholders.

  • Independently identify inefficiencies, propose solutions, and implement reusable tools and automations.

Desired Skills, Experience, and Education:



  • Ability to work effectively in broad, minimally defined design spaces and to communicate technical results clearly.

  • 5 or more years related technical experience or an equivalent combination of education and experience.

  • Active Tier 5 (T5) Clearance, formerly known as Single Scope Background Investigation (SSBI) is Preferred.

  • Experience with spacecraft operations, space environment effects, or hypersonic re entry GN&C.

  • Programming experience in C/C++ or comparable languages sufficient to implement and test GN&C algorithms.

  • Familiarity with state estimation and sensor fusion (e.g., Kalman filters), GPS/INS, or air data systems.

  • Background in classical and modern control theory and nonlinear control design.

  • Model based development experience and flight test support.
